They only won 87 games, finished 3rd in their 5 team division, they weren’t even the classic “hot down the stretch” team winning 7 of their last 20, but they are going to the World Series making a mockery of the regular season. Spare me then”winning when it counts” that’s just marketing bs you’ve been duped to believe. Anything can happen in a small sample size, especially in baseball a sport where marginal differences play out over time. the 60 wins A’s swept the 106 win Astros in a 3 game set.
Playoffs should have been Dodgers Braves Astros Yankees, the best teams all year

The BCS championship was meant to resolve the case where 2 undefeated P5 schools never played each other and were relying on AP votes to claim a national championship.
The CFP resolves the case of having 3 undefeated schools in that same scenario.
What problem does expanding CFP solve? As it is team 4 normally gets their teeth kicked in.
Let the fans of, say, number 6 Michigan travel down to Florida for a vacation to a warm New Years bowl game against number 9 TCU. That’s a perfectly valid conclusion to a good but not spectacular amateur athletic year.
Don’t worry about sending them to Georgia for a road game curbstomping in the name of TV views.
